El jugador controla a Crash, un bandicut mejorado genéticamente creado por el científico loco Doctor Neo Cortex. La historia sigue a Crash en su intento de frustrar los planes de Cortex para dominar el mundo y rescatar a su novia Tawna, una bandicut femenina también creada por Cortex. Crash Bandicoot is a video game franchise originally developed by Naughty Dog as an exclusive for Sony's PlayStation console. It has seen numerous installments created by various developers and published on multiple platforms.
